Lyrically speaking, “Clock Out and Kick Back” is an anthem for the tired and underappreciated. The lyrics tell the story of the rush of the work week leading to the joyous time when the boss says “goodbye”. The chorus rings out with “Hang up the hard hat” {and “Grab a fishing rod” resonate deeply with the blue-collar dreamer. Separating itself from generic party anthems, this song has a genuine heart. Musically, the track features a timeless arrangement. The song kicks off with a twangy electric guitar before the rhythm section enters with a four-on-the-floor drum pattern. The refrain elevates the energy with a wall of sound. The mixing is professional yet warm. This clarity highlights his vocals to shine through.
